  Word Explanations quip, largess, amass, wistful, subversive, collage, hew, metaphysical, seclusion, tellurian


   
Explanation of quip (noun)
witty remark; sally



   
Explanation of largess (noun)
liberality in bestowing gifts; magnanimity; openhandedness



   
Explanation of amass (verb)
forms: amassed; amassed; amassing

get or gather together; accumulate; pile up; compile; hoard



   
Explanation of wistful (adjective)
showing pensive sadness



   
Explanation of subversive (adjective)
in opposition to a civil authority or government



   
Explanation of collage (noun)
any collection of diverse things



   
Explanation of hew (verb)
forms: hewed; hewed, hewn; hewing

strike with an axe



   
Explanation of metaphysical (adjective)
highly abstract and overly theoretical



   
Explanation of seclusion (noun)
form: seclusions

the act of secluding yourself from others



   
Explanation of tellurian (adjective)
of or relating to or inhabiting the land as opposed to the sea or air; terrestrial; terrene
